What Are Peer Educators?
Peer Educators are trained individuals who share common backgrounds or experiences with the communities they serve. They play a vital role in health promotion by offering relatable support, education, and guidance—building trust and breaking down barriers to care.
The Role of Neftaly Peer Educators
- Community Outreach: Engaging with local populations to raise awareness about health issues, prevention, and wellness programs.
- Health Education: Delivering workshops, informational sessions, and one-on-one support on topics such as mental health, chronic disease management, substance use, sexual health, and more.
- Advocacy and Support: Helping individuals navigate health services and access resources, while advocating for the needs and voices of their communities.
- Building Connections: Creating safe spaces for dialogue and peer support to foster resilience and positive health behaviors.
Why Peer Educators Matter
Peer Educators bring unique credibility and empathy to health initiatives, making education more accessible and impactful. Their first-hand understanding helps reduce stigma, increase engagement, and promote sustainable behavior change.
